Understanding the Importance of Research
When it comes to sports betting, understanding the importance of research is crucial to making informed decisions. Analyzing sports matchups requires a deep understanding of various factors that can influence the outcome of a game. This includes studying the teams’ performance, players’ statistics, injuries, weather conditions, and historical data. In order to improve your odds of winning, it’s essential to invest time and effort in thorough research.
Key Statistical Metrics to Consider
One of the most effective ways to analyze sports matchups is by utilizing key statistical metrics. These metrics can provide valuable insights into the strengths and weaknesses of each team, allowing you to make more accurate predictions. Some of the essential statistical metrics to consider include points scored, rebounds, assists, field goal percentage, three-point percentage, free throw percentage, turnovers, and more. By incorporating these metrics into your analysis, you can gain a better understanding of how two teams stack up against each other.
The Impact of Home and Away Advantage
Another important aspect to consider when analyzing sports matchups is the impact of home and away advantage. Research has shown that home teams often have a slight edge over their opponents due to factors such as familiarity with the court or field, supportive fans, and reduced travel fatigue. However, this advantage can vary depending on the sport and the specific teams involved. By carefully evaluating the home and away records of the competing teams, you can factor this into your analysis and make more accurate betting decisions.
Utilizing Advanced Analytics and Technology
In recent years, the world of sports analysis has been revolutionized by advanced analytics and technology. With the emergence of predictive modeling, machine learning, and data visualization tools, sports bettors now have access to more sophisticated methods for analyzing matchups. These tools can help in identifying patterns, trends, and correlations that may not be immediately apparent through traditional analysis. By leveraging advanced analytics and technology, you can gain a competitive edge and improve your ability to make successful predictions.
The Importance of Emotional Control
While it’s essential to utilize data and statistical analysis when evaluating sports matchups, it’s equally important to maintain emotional control and discipline. Emotional decisions driven by bias or personal preferences can lead to poor betting choices. Successful sports bettors understand the value of rational thinking and are able to separate their emotions from their decisions. By practicing emotional control and staying focused on the data, you can make more logical and informed bets.
